Schedule : Up to 21 hours per week, 12 weeks, fully onsite
This is an unpaid internship – applicant must provide proof for receiving school credit.
As directed by the IT Services Manager, the IT Technician Intern performs IT projects specifically focused on Microsoft systems architecture and the Microsoft Active Directory infrastructure. The IT Intern will focus on learning to navigate, update, and troubleshoot issues within enterprise Microsoft infrastructure including on premise Active Directory, Entra ID, Intune and Microsoft System Center Configuration Manager (SCCM). Additional experience with Microsoft Power Automate and PowerBI is also available. The IT Intern receives project assignments from the IT Services Manager and uses documented processes and procedures to execute required duties. The IT Technician Intern’s duties will conform to standard collegiate internship requirements and norms by being employed in professional Microsoft Systems Administration roles. Superior customer service and interpersonal skills are also required.
